diff --git a/serde_derive/src/internals/attr.rs b/serde_derive/src/internals/attr.rs index 64ed04f6..e338deb6 100644 --- a/serde_derive/src/internals/attr.rs +++ b/serde_derive/src/internals/attr.rs @@ -6,7 +6,7 @@ use quote::ToTokens; use std::borrow::Cow; use std::collections::BTreeSet; use syn; -use syn::parse::{self, Parse, ParseStream}; +use syn::parse::{Parse, ParseStream}; use syn::punctuated::Punctuated; use syn::Ident; use syn::Meta::{List, NameValue, Path}; @@ -1665,7 +1665,7 @@ fn parse_lit_into_lifetimes( struct BorrowedLifetimes(Punctuated); impl Parse for BorrowedLifetimes { - fn parse(input: ParseStream) -> parse::Result { + fn parse(input: ParseStream) -> syn::Result { Punctuated::parse_separated_nonempty(input).map(BorrowedLifetimes) } } @@ -1934,7 +1934,7 @@ fn collect_lifetimes_from_tokens(tokens: TokenStream, out: &mut BTreeSet(s: &syn::LitStr) -> parse::Result +fn parse_lit_str(s: &syn::LitStr) -> syn::Result where T: Parse, { @@ -1942,7 +1942,7 @@ where syn::parse2(tokens) } -fn spanned_tokens(s: &syn::LitStr) -> parse::Result { +fn spanned_tokens(s: &syn::LitStr) -> syn::Result { let stream = syn::parse_str(&s.value())?; Ok(respan(stream, s.span())) }